Scientific Background

BPC-157 is derived from a portion of the endogenous peptide BPC, a gastric juice protein, and is used in research to analyse the biochemical signalling pathways associated with tissue communication and repair processes. Various publications describe interactions with cellular networks, angiogenesis and modulation of local microenvironments in experimental models.

Due to these properties, BPC-157 is regularly studied in combination with other peptides such as TB-500 within compound research settings, for example the Wolverine Stack (BPC-157 and TB-500).

Potential Research Areas and Effects

In controlled research designs, BPC-157 has been studied in various experimental contexts. Key research areas include:

Tissue repair and regeneration

Experimental models aimed at soft tissue repair following damage.

Cell migration

Study of cell movement within experimental environments.

Angiogenesis

Research into the formation of new blood vessels within predefined models.

Biochemical signal modulation

Analysis of the effects of BPC-157 on local cellular and molecular signals.

These research areas are based on scientific literature and preclinical data and serve solely as context for research in controlled environments.
